Ghanshyam Patel, a proud son of Madhya Pradesh, carries forward the rich legacy of Bundeli folk music, deeply inspired by his father, Ghooman Prasad Kushwaha.
With over a decade of experience, Ghanshyam has performed folk genres like Aalha, Rai, and Bhajan in government sponsored cultural programmes across various Indian States. Beyond music, he is the president of an NGO, working towards preserving India’s cultural heritage.
